Venturi Oxygen Delivery Systems: Technical Engineering & Application in Uruguay’s Healthcare Ecosystem

In severe respiratory management, exact control over the Fraction of Inspired Oxygen ($\text{FiO}_2$) is a non-negotiable determinant of clinical outcomes. Venturi masks—also referred to as variable concentration oxygen masks—operate upon the fundamental principles of fluid dynamics governed by the Bernoulli Principle and the Venturi Effect. By accelerating oxygen flow through a fixed-diameter orifice, a localized negative pressure zone is created, drawing ambient air into the stream at a precise, pre-calculated ratio. Fluid Dynamic Mechanics of Air Entrainment Diluters

The accuracy of a Venturi mask relies entirely on the micro-machining tolerances of the color-coded diluter valves. As oxygen travels under pressure through the narrow nozzle inside the diluter, its velocity increases while static pressure decreases. Ambient air ports situated downstream allow room air (21% $\text{O}_2$) to blend with the pure oxygen stream. The ratio of air to oxygen dictates the final concentration delivered to the patient's airway:

Diluter Color Code Target $\text{FiO}_2$ Concentration Required Oxygen Flow Rate (L/min) Air-to-Oxygen Entrainment Ratio Total Flow Delivered to Patient (L/min)
Blue 24% 2 L/min 25:1 52 L/min
White 28% 4 L/min 10:1 44 L/min
Yellow 31% 6 L/min 7:1 48 L/min
Green 35% 8 L/min 4.6:1 45 L/min
Pink 40% 8 L/min 3:1 32 L/min
Orange 50% 12 L/min 1.7:1 32 L/min

When total gas flow exceeds the patient’s peak inspiratory demand (typically 30 to 40 L/min in dyspneic patients), room air entrainment around the edges of the mask facepiece is eliminated. This ensures the patient breathes the exact prescribed $\text{FiO}_2$, protecting individuals with hypoxic drive dependent COPD against oxygen-induced hypercapnia.

Local Market Trends & Regional Dynamics

Navigating Medical Disposable Procurement in Uruguay’s Healthcare Sector

Uruguay boasts one of the most structured and centralized healthcare delivery systems in South America, governed by the Ministry of Public Health (MSP - Ministerio de Salud Pública). The National Integrated Health System (SNIS - Sistema Nacional Integrado de Salud) bridges public hospitals under ASSE and private insurance conglomerates. For global medical device manufacturers and export suppliers targeting Montevideo, Salto, and Paysandú, understanding localized operational dynamics is critical.

1. Epidemiological Demand Patterns & Seasonal Spikes

Uruguay experiences distinct Southern Hemisphere winter seasonality (May to September), resulting in sharp surges in acute lower respiratory infections (ALRI), respiratory syncytial virus (RSV), and exacerbations of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(EPOC). Public intensive care units (ICUs) and emergency wards scale up oxygen therapy consumable inventories months prior. 2. Regulatory Registration & MSP Compliance (Decree 3/008)

Importing single-use medical disposables into Uruguay mandates product registration with the MSP under Decreto 3/008. Importers require complete technical dossiers containing ISO 13485:2016 quality system certificates, EU CE Mark declarations of conformity, biocompatibility data (ISO 10993 series), and validated ethylene oxide (EO) sterilization release records.
